Ticket: ScaleRight update fails signature check

Several users report the recipe-scaling calculator update refuses to install, citing an invalid signature. Build 3.1.4, pulled from the Oatmere mirror. Likely a stale mirror copy. Ask users to re-download from the primary feed, then verify the package against the current signing key below.

deploy key for kajof-yawif: bky9_fvxrpdHPq

## Glimmertile Cache — Limits & Quotas

The Glimmertile render cache caps memory per worker and evicts LRU. Exceeding the tile-size limit bypasses cache entirely — watch for render CPU spikes if that happens at volume. Quota resets hourly per tenant. Do not raise limits during an incident; shed load at the gateway instead and page the Fenbrook maps team. Current constants are below.

limits module of tafop-hahop:
WEIGHTS = {
    "julmir": 223,
    "belox": 987,
    "lamion": 470,
    "pelath": 609,
    "fraok": 1010,
    "eliion": 343,
    "drudor": 342,
}

Subject: Key rotation — Stormfan alert fan-out

Welcome aboard. As part of our quarterly rotation, the credential used by the Stormfan service to fan out weather alerts to regional notifier nodes has been replaced. The old key stops working Friday at noon. Please update your local config for the staging fan-out worker before then; production is handled by the platform team. The new key for the Stormfan internal API is below.

gateway credential: kto23_LX9A4ys6i4nzHtpOLNLodKK